What is a 6312 ZZ Bearing?
The designation 6312 ZZ describes a specific type of deep groove ball bearing. The 63 indicates the series, while 12 refers to the bore diameter, which is 60 mm in this case. The ZZ refers to metal shields on both sides of the bearing, providing additional protection against dirt and debris. These features make the 6312 ZZ bearing suitable for various industrial applications, including electric motors, conveyors, and agricultural machinery.
Factors Influencing the Price
1. Material Quality The materials used in manufacturing bearings significantly affect their performance and longevity. High-quality steel or stainless steel is essential for durability. Bearings made from higher-grade materials will naturally come at a higher price point due to the increased production costs and the benefits they provide in terms of longevity and reliability.
2. Manufacturer Reputation Renowned manufacturers that are known for producing high-quality bearings may charge more for their products. Brand reputation is often a reflection of the quality and reliability of the bearings. Established brands typically invest in research and development, technology, and quality control processes, which can be reflected in their pricing.
3. Production Volume The pricing of bearings can also depend on the volume of production. Mass-produced bearings benefit from economies of scale, often resulting in lower prices. In contrast, custom or low-volume bearings may be priced higher due to the specialized manufacturing processes involved.
4. Market Demand Prices fluctuate based on market demand and supply. During periods of high demand for various applications, the price of bearings, including the 6312 ZZ model, may increase. Additionally, global supply chain issues and economic conditions can also impact prices.
5. Retail vs. Wholesale Pricing Consumers purchasing bearings in bulk may find that wholesale prices are significantly lower than retail prices. This is an important consideration for businesses looking to manage costs effectively.
6. Packaging and Accessories Sometimes, the price includes packaging or additional accessories, such as grease or installation kits. Buyers should consider whether the price reflects only the bearing or additional components essential for installation and maintenance.
Evaluating Price and Quality
When considering the price of a 6312 ZZ bearing, it’s crucial to evaluate both the cost and the quality provided. While it might be tempting to opt for the cheapest option available, this can lead to higher costs in the long run due to premature failure or performance issues. It’s always wise to balance price with the expected lifespan and reliability of the bearing.
